🗣 'I thought it'd be worse than that, so positive.' Lewis Hamilton admits that he didn’t expect to make it through to Q3 at the BahrainGP after his Mercedes F1 team struggled for pace earlier in the weekend ⬇️
Hamilton said that the team had made some good progress after a difficult Bahrain test and a disappointing start to the race weekend on Friday.
“I thought we would struggle to get into Q3, but we didn’t, we're in there, and in amongst the fight."Hamilton admitted theW14 is still lacking rear-end stability, although he believes it has been improved through the race weekend. “Same story you have in previous years. Before last year we had better rear end. It’s something we can work on."Mercedes experimented with two rear wing set-ups over the weekend, with Hamilton focussing on the new lower drag version that was more tailored for the Sakhir track than the one used in testing last week.
Asked if he was confident that it was the right choice, he said:"Who knows? It was pretty much the same. We did the same times on both the wings."
